For adding a delete prompt on a datatable (looks like its going to be a datagrid in UI), you would need to bind the javascript to prompt for this alert during the ItemDataBound/RowDataBound event of the datagrid.
In this event, while the data is binded row by row - add something like:
LinkButton l = (LinkButton)e.Row.FindControl("LinkButton1");
l.Attributes.Add("onclick", "javascript:return " +
"confirm('Are you sure you want to delete this record')");
Alternatively,
if the link button in ItemTemplate of datagrid has OnclientClick event exposed (which is present in ASP.NET2.0 onwards), you can add something like:
OnClientClick = 'return confirm("Are you sure you want to delete this entry?");'
